Government House, Hong Kong, 14 & November 1876
My Lord
I have the honour to forward, for Your Lordship's consideration, an application from Mr. Creagh, Deputy Superintendent of Police, for an increase of salary of forty dollars.
The Right Honorable
The Earl of Carnarvon,
Her Majesty's Principal Secretary of State
